About Réjean Ducharme

Réjean Ducharme is a scholar working on Software, Management Science and Operations Research, Soil Science, Demography and Artificial Intelligence, having authored 7 papers that have together received 715 indexed citations. Recurring topics across this work include Energy Load and Power Forecasting (1 paper), Insurance, Mortality, Demography, Risk Management (1 paper), Neural Networks and Applications (1 paper), Software Reliability and Analysis Research (1 paper), Data Quality and Management (1 paper), Software Engineering Research (1 paper), Natural Language Processing Techniques (1 paper) and Agricultural risk and resilience (1 paper). The work is most often cited by research in Artificial Intelligence (577 citations), Health Informatics (11 citations), Signal Processing (53 citations), Computer Vision and Pattern Recognition (80 citations) and Management Science and Operations Research (40 citations). Réjean Ducharme has collaborated with scholars based in Canada. Frequent co-authors include Yoshua Bengio, Pascal Vincent, Nicolas Chapados and Charles Dugas. Their work appears in journals such as International Journal of Business Intelligence and Data Mining, IEEE Transactions on Neural Networks, Gallimard eBooks and Books Abroad.
